少儿机器人学什么编程好
-
少儿机器人学编程是一种非常有益的活动,可以帮助孩子们培养逻辑思维能力、动手能力和创造力。在选择学习编程的时候,有几个方面是需要考虑的。
首先,语言选择。对于少儿学习编程来说,Scratch是一个非常好的选择。Scratch是一种图形化编程语言,适合初学者入门。它使用拖拽积木的方式来编写代码,不需要掌握复杂的语法规则,让孩子们可以更轻松地理解和学习编程。
其次,学习内容。在学习编程过程中,可以选择一些与机器人相关的项目。比如,学习如何编写代码控制机器人移动、识别颜色、跟随线路等等。这样的项目可以帮助孩子们将编程与实际应用结合起来,增加学习的趣味性和动力。
另外,还可以选择一些与机器人编程相关的教育机构或培训班。这些机构通常会提供系统的课程和教学资源,帮助孩子们更好地学习编程知识,并且可以与其他同龄人一起学习和交流。
最后,需要重视实践。学习编程最重要的是实践,通过动手操作和实际应用来巩固所学知识。可以购买一些适合少儿学习的机器人套装,让孩子们亲自动手组装和编程,体验编程的乐趣。
总的来说,少儿机器人学编程选择适合初学者的编程语言,选择与机器人相关的项目,可以考虑参加相关的培训班,同时注重实践,这样可以帮助孩子们更好地学习编程知识,培养他们的创造力和动手能力。
1年前 -
少儿学习机器人编程有很多好处,可以培养孩子的创造力、逻辑思维和解决问题的能力。以下是几种适合少儿学习的机器人编程语言和平台。
-
Scratch:Scratch是一种由麻省理工学院开发的图形化编程语言,适合初学者学习。孩子可以通过拖拽积木来创建程序,而不需要编写复杂的代码。Scratch提供了丰富的教学资源和社区支持,孩子可以通过与其他学习者交流和分享项目来提升编程技能。
-
LEGO Mindstorms:LEGO Mindstorms是一套由乐高公司开发的机器人编程平台,适合孩子学习机器人编程和建模。孩子可以使用乐高积木搭建机器人,并使用图形化编程软件来编写程序。LEGO Mindstorms具有可扩展性,可以通过添加传感器和执行器来扩展机器人的功能。
-
Arduino:Arduino是一种开源的电子原型平台,适合稍大一些的孩子学习。孩子可以学习如何使用Arduino控制器和编写基于C语言的代码来控制电子设备。Arduino具有丰富的传感器和执行器,可以用于构建各种有趣的机器人项目。
-
Python:Python是一种简洁而易学的编程语言,适合较为有经验的孩子学习。Python具有广泛的应用领域,包括机器人编程。孩子可以使用Python编写更复杂的机器人程序,并与各种硬件进行交互。
-
VEX Robotics:VEX Robotics是一套教育机器人编程平台,适合中学生学习。该平台提供了机器人构建套件、图形化编程软件和在线教学资源。孩子可以通过使用VEX Robotics平台来学习机器人编程和工程技能。
无论选择哪种机器人编程语言或平台,重要的是让孩子通过实践来学习。通过构建和编程机器人项目,孩子可以锻炼解决问题的能力、团队合作和创造力。此外,家长或老师的指导和支持也是非常重要的,他们可以提供帮助和鼓励,帮助孩子克服困难并取得进步。
1年前 -
-
少儿机器人编程是培养孩子逻辑思维和创造力的一种方法。在选择编程语言时,应该考虑孩子的年龄、兴趣和学习能力。以下是一些适合少儿学习的编程语言和编程方法。
-
可视化编程语言
可视化编程语言是一种通过拖拽和连接图形化模块来编写程序的方法,适合初学者和年龄较小的孩子。其中Scratch是最受欢迎的可视化编程语言之一,它提供了一个简单的界面和丰富的图形化模块,可以用来创建交互式故事、游戏和动画。另外,Blockly是一种基于块状编程的语言,也是一个很好的选择。 -
文字编程语言
文字编程语言需要孩子学习编程语法和语义,适合年龄较大的孩子。Python是一种简单易学的文字编程语言,它的语法简洁明了,可以用来编写各种类型的程序。另外,JavaScript也是一种常用的文字编程语言,它可以用来制作网页、游戏和应用程序。 -
机器人编程
机器人编程是将编程与机器人技术相结合,通过编写程序来控制机器人的行为。Lego Mindstorms是一个非常受欢迎的机器人编程平台,它使用可视化编程语言和机器人套件,可以让孩子们设计、构建和编程自己的机器人。另外,mBot和Arduino也是一些常用的机器人编程平台。 -
游戏编程
游戏编程是一种有趣的编程方法,可以让孩子们通过编写游戏来学习编程。Unity是一个流行的游戏开发引擎,它使用C#语言进行编程,可以用来制作各种类型的游戏。另外,GameMaker和Scratch也是一些适合少儿学习的游戏编程工具。 -
电子积木编程
电子积木编程是一种将电子和编程相结合的方法,可以让孩子们通过连接电子模块来编写程序。Arduino和Micro:bit是一些常用的电子积木编程平台,它们提供了丰富的电子模块和简单易学的编程语言,可以用来制作各种电子项目。
总之,选择适合孩子学习的编程方法和语言是非常重要的。可以根据孩子的年龄、兴趣和学习能力来选择合适的编程语言和平台,通过编程培养孩子的逻辑思维、创造力和解决问题的能力。
1年前 -